100% de satisfacción garantizada Inmediatamente disponible después del pago Tanto en línea como en PDF No estas atado a nada 4.2 TrustPilot
logo-home
Resumen

Summary and Flashcards - Database Systems

Puntuación
-
Vendido
-
Páginas
61
Subido en
25-06-2024
Escrito en
2023/2024

In-depth notes and flashcards going over databases. Models, difference between information and data, scheme architecture and modelling, relationship models. Document and key value databases (Redis, Amazon DynamoDB), graph databases, DMS and DSMS, multi-user access control, backup and integrity management. CRUD, business rules, SQL in detail, mappings and entities. Domains and attributes, operators in SQL and querying. Constraints in databases, EERMs, types of hierarchies, database normalisation, functional dependencies, introduction to database algebra, indexing and normal forms. Transaction locks and ACID properties. Redudancy control and much more.

Mostrar más Leer menos
Institución
Grado











Ups! No podemos cargar tu documento ahora. Inténtalo de nuevo o contacta con soporte.

Escuela, estudio y materia

Institución
Estudio
Desconocido
Grado

Información del documento

Subido en
25 de junio de 2024
Número de páginas
61
Escrito en
2023/2024
Tipo
Resumen

Temas

Vista previa del contenido

Database Systems (COM1025)
https://labs.azure.com/virtualmachines



1) What is data? Data are raw, unanalysed facts.
▪ Data can be alphanumeric,
images and videos
▪ Data is the building blocks of
information

Data today has volume, velocity, variety – Big
Data

2) What is information? Information is data that has been processed into
a
meaningful form

Information is the base of knowledge and
decision-making.

3) What is knowledge? Knowledge is the capacity to use information for
making decisions.

4) What is a database? A collection of interrelated data, designed for an
organisation’s information needs.
▪ Access to accurate, relevant and
timely information is
critical for most organisations’ success.




5) What are the problems with file based ▪ Storage of duplicate or
databases compared to digital ones? redundant data
▪ Risk of data becoming
inconsistent
▪ Close coupling between
applications and data
▪ Difficult to integrate applications
▪ Difficult to provide concurrent
access to data

6) Why do we use databases? ▪ Data Independence – duplication,
inconsistency

, is minimised
▪ Data Persistence - sharable in a
secure way
▪ Data Abstraction - data models
key to database design

7) How are databases managed?




▪ Database Management System
(DBMS): define, create,
maintain, control access to database
▪ Application Programs: used to
interact with database




8) What is a model? What is a data model? A model is a simplified, miniature or abstract
representation of a real-world object or event

A data model is a collection of concepts for
representing complex real-world data in an
organisation in an abstract way.
▪ Objects/event (entities)
▪ Relationships (e.g. one-to-many,
many-to-many, one-to-one)
▪ Constraints

9) What are the benefits of data modelling? ▪ Provides an abstraction so no
need to be concerned with

, implementation
▪ Facilitates communication
between designer and user by
representing data in an
understandable way
▪ Provides different views to
different users
▪ An accurate data model is key to
good design




10) What is schema? The description of a database at a logical level
(usually in a formal language) supported by the
DBMS’s logical model.

, 11) What are the levels of a schema Physical Level
architecture? ▪ Storage structure of data
External Level
▪ Tailored to be viewed by a
particular category of users
▪ Hides data for security
Conceptual/Internal Level
▪ Defines the logical structure
▪ Bridge between the External
and Physical Levels




12) Why is database design important? ▪ A Database is designed to solve
problems presented by real use
cases
▪ Well-designed database gives
accurate information
▪ Badly designed database can
cause errors that lead to poor
decision making
▪ Data abstraction is key to good
design
▪ A database model consists of
different data models
$6.91
Accede al documento completo:

100% de satisfacción garantizada
Inmediatamente disponible después del pago
Tanto en línea como en PDF
No estas atado a nada

Conoce al vendedor
Seller avatar
williamdaniel

Documento también disponible en un lote

Conoce al vendedor

Seller avatar
williamdaniel University of Surrey
Seguir Necesitas iniciar sesión para seguir a otros usuarios o asignaturas
Vendido
0
Miembro desde
1 año
Número de seguidores
0
Documentos
8
Última venta
-

0.0

0 reseñas

5
0
4
0
3
0
2
0
1
0

Recientemente visto por ti

Por qué los estudiantes eligen Stuvia

Creado por compañeros estudiantes, verificado por reseñas

Calidad en la que puedes confiar: escrito por estudiantes que aprobaron y evaluado por otros que han usado estos resúmenes.

¿No estás satisfecho? Elige otro documento

¡No te preocupes! Puedes elegir directamente otro documento que se ajuste mejor a lo que buscas.

Paga como quieras, empieza a estudiar al instante

Sin suscripción, sin compromisos. Paga como estés acostumbrado con tarjeta de crédito y descarga tu documento PDF inmediatamente.

Student with book image

“Comprado, descargado y aprobado. Así de fácil puede ser.”

Alisha Student

Preguntas frecuentes